Using reserves gets cool reception from council

North Bay councillors shutdown a suggestion to use its reserve fund to replace the John Street Bridge this year.  The idea came from Mark King who opposes delaying the work another year.  When King suggested dipping into reserves to carry out the work this year, he was met with several protests.  They include the deputy mayor Tanya Vrebosch who says reserves should only be used in emergencies.
